The Pursuit of Sentience: Can AI Understand Emotions?
Artificial intelligence continues to evolve, blurring the lines between machine and human. While AI excels in logical functions, replicating the complexities of human emotional intelligence remains a formidable obstacle. Can algorithms truly comprehend emotions like joy, sorrow, or anger? Or are these experiences uniquely biological?
Some researchers believe that AI could one day simulate emotional intelligence through advanced algorithms. These systems could learn to decode human facial expressions, tone of voice, and textual cues, allowing them to respond in a more emotionally intelligent manner.
However, others caution that true emotional intelligence may be unachievable. They highlight the subjective and complex nature of emotions, which are often influenced by personal experiences, cultural beliefs, and unconscious motivations.
